Responsibilities and Role Overview
As an Informatica Developer, you will be tasked with supporting key data engineering and governance initiatives. Core duties include requirements analysis, designing ETL workflows, and ensuring data quality.
Your role will involve interpreting business objectives and addressing problems by identifying alternative solutions. You’ll review current procedures, detecting gaps and optimizing workflows.
Additionally, you’ll document user needs and system functions, guiding development or modification of programs. Creativity and independent judgment are encouraged for process improvement.
The position expects you to wield Informatica tools such as PowerCenter, MDM, and Data Quality tools. Experience in managing large data sets and implementing advanced data quality rules is valuable.
